Popular Coffee Creamer Recalled in 31 States: Check the Brand and Flavors

More than 75,000 bottles of International Delight coffee creamer have been recalled amid complaints of spoilage and illness,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ration said this week.

If you like flavored creamers, you’ll want to check your fridge: Two popular flavors have been pulled from store shelves across 31 states.

Which coffee creamers are being recalled?

The recall involves two flavors of International Delight coffee creamer sold in 32-ounce (1 quart) bottles:

Hazelnut International Delight Coffee Creamer

  • Best-Used-By Date: July 3, 2025
  • Recall Number: F-0626-2025
  • UPC: 0 41271 02565 2

Cinnabon Classic Cinnamon Roll International Delight Coffee Creamer

  • Best-Used-By Date: July 2, 2025
  • Recall Number: F-0625-2025
  • UPC: 0 41271 01993 3

The recall was initiated voluntarily by Danone North America, International Delight’s parent company, following consumer complaints of spoiled texture and illness.

Is This a Food Safety Risk?

Danone said that these products do not meet the quality standards of the company since they may spoil too fast, although there is no indication of a direct risk to food safety.

“We take every concern to heart, because this is not the quality we strive for,” said the company in a statement.

Where were the recalled products sold?

The recalled creamers were distributed to 31 states nationwide, including:

Alabama, Arkansas, Colorado, Connecticut, Florida, Georgia, Illinois, Indiana, Kentucky, Louisiana, Maryland, Maine, Michigan, Minnesota, Missouri, Mississippi, North Carolina, Nebraska,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New Mexico, New York,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, Tennessee, Texas, Virginia, Wisconsin, and Wyoming.

If you purchased an International Delight Hazelnut or Cinnabon Classic Cinnamon Roll creamer in any of these states, please check the label for the Best-Used-By Date and UPC code.

What should you do if you have one of these creamers?

The FDA recommends discarding any affected creamer immediately.

  • In case you have already consumed the product and feel unwell, go to the hospital.
  • Consumers may contact International Delight’s Consumer Care Line at 1-(800)-441-3321 for a refund or for more information.

Product recalls are never fun, but especially not when they involve spoilage and potential health concerns since flavored coffee creamers are a morning staple for millions. This recall falls amidst increased scrutiny over food safety and quality control.

Danone insists that it is not a major health risk, but people are skeptical of food spoilage and manufacturing problems. If you, or someone you know, regularly purchases the International Delight coffee creamers, check your fridge and take action. Better safe than sorry.
